Hi Steven - does your truck have a two piece driveshaft - if it does there will be a centre bearing bolted to a chassis crossmember which you could check out - if its bad you should also be able to hear a rumbling sound while driving at a moderate speed.
I would continue back down the drivetrain checking the universal joints , shackle bushes, - anything that could be loose etc.

D9TZ-4800-A .. Driveshaft Center Support Kit / Available from Ford.
Applications: 1961/79 F100/250 / 1975/79 F150 / Misc 1980/89 F100/250's.
Kit includes the bearing, U shaped rubber support and bracket, shims.
